Gary Neville and his wife faced verbal abuse from a man walking a highly aggressive dog during a stroll through Manchester earlier this week. Neville expressed fear that the man might unleash the dog on them.
Details of the Confrontation
A video circulating on X shows the man hurling insults at Neville, repeatedly calling him a ‘f****** w******’ and a ‘p****’. Neville paused upon hearing his name, appearing shocked by the unprovoked attack.
The couple had just attended a James concert in Manchester alongside Neville’s former Manchester United teammate, Roy Keane.
Neville’s Reaction on Podcast
Speaking on the Stick to Football podcast, Neville regretted not recording the incident himself. He stated: “He had, I’m presuming, a very aggressive dog on a lead. I thought he was going to let the dog go. I thought it was one of them where he was gonna go like that [releasing the lead].”
Neville highlighted the distress of the event, especially in his wife’s presence: “That’s the bit that’s wrong. It’s the first time it’s happened like that, but when you’re with your wife…”
Podcast Hosts Condemn the Abuse
Fellow hosts on the podcast strongly denounced the harassment. Ian Wright remarked: “That was a mean one. It’s just horrible.”
Jill Scott added: “It was so out of order,” noting she would have confronted the man physically.
